<p>Over the past four years, Apple has changed the way we think about mobile computing. The iOS Platform has changed the way that we, the public, think about our mobile computing devices. With full-featured applications and an interface architecture that demonstrates that small screens can be effective workspaces, the iPhone has become the smartphone of choice for users and developers alike.<br />
Part of what makes the iPhone such a success is the combination of an amazing interface and an effective software distribution method. With Apple, the user experience is key. The iOS is designed to be controlled with your fingers rather by using a stylus or keypad. The applications are “natural” and fun to use, instead of looking and behaving like a clumsy port of a desktop app. Everything from interface to application performance and battery lifehas been considered. The same cannot be said for the competition.<span id="more-743"></span> Through the App Store, Apple has created the ultimate digital distribution system for developers. Programmers of any age or affiliation can submit their applications to the App Store for just the cost of a modest yearly Developer Membership fee. Games, utilities, and full-feature applications have been built for everything from pre-K education to retirement living. No matter what the content, with a user base as large as the iPhone, an audience exists. In 2010, Apple introduced the iPad and iPhone 4 platforms—bringing larger, faster, and<br />

Popular acceptance of the smartphone has brought technology once only previously imagined in science fiction to today’s reality. You can now use the small electronic device that used to be a simple cell phone to manage your calendar, listen to music, take pictures, provide maps and navigation, and browse the Internet—and still make a phone call. The technology that links you to the vast information store on the Internet any time and anywhere is perhaps the greatest revolution in information access the world has seen. Not only available to the developed nations where we expect to see high-end smartphones, these devices are also widely available indeveloping nations, where they are often the primary device people use to access the Internet.<div class="adsense_inside_post">

The iPhone is a global device that uses the international standard GSM protocol. Unlocking the<br />
phone so that it can use SI M cards anywhere is a major industry, and will probably continue to be<br />
so even after Apple’s exclusive contracts with mobile carriers are gone.<br />
The iPod touch is the heir apparent of the iPod, and once flash memory sizes surpass hard drives,<br />
the iPod touch will be the iPod. But this iPod surfs the Web, gets email, and maps your location,<br />
and new applications are constantly being developed for it. The impulse to get the iPod—already<br />
the de facto standard MP3 player—to do even more is irresistible.</p>
